#7f5850 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7f5850 is composed of 49.8% red, 34.5%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 30.7% magenta, 37% yellow and 50.2% black. It has a hue angle of 10.2 degrees, a saturation of 22.7% and a lightness of 40.6%. #7f5850 color hex could be obtained by blending #feb0a0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

Shades and Tints of #7f5850

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070504 is the darkest color, while #fcfafa is the lightest one.

Tones of #7f5850

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6f6360 is the less saturated color, while #cf2300 is the most saturated one.
